Scientific and technical journal articles in Mercosur in 2023 — 68,391 articles. Since 1996, the indicator has risen by 508.4%.

The number of scientific and technical articles published during the year in peer-reviewed journals in the natural sciences and engineering, medicine, agriculture and mathematics. Articles are counted by the country of the authors' affiliation; under international co-authorship an article is counted for each country, so the sum over countries exceeds the world total.
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ics (UIS), license CC BY-SA 3.0 IGO.
